Released in 1940, Rózsafabot is a drame and romance film directed by Béla Balogh, running about 86 minutes.
What it’s about. After having spent 22 months in prison, Viktor Pálos returns to his homeland, where he is going to be involved in the robbery committed by his relatives.
Who’s in it. Rózsafabot stars Zita Szeleczky as Katalin Sipos, József Timár as Viktor Pálos, Kálmán Rózsahegyi as István Berek and Lili Berky as Anna, among others.
